The 1881 Census reveals a detailed snapshot of households in England, Wales and Scotland. The census was taken on April 3rd and the total population was recorded as 29,707,207.
In the 1881 Census, the household of Jeffrey C Johnson, born in 1835 in Blackwell, Durham, consisted of 6 members. Jeffrey C was the head of the household, married to Elizabeth L Johnson, born in 1837 in Darlington, Durham, England. They had 2 children; George H (born 1863 in Manfield, Yorkshire, England) and Elizabeth (born 1864 in Manfield, Yorkshire, England).
During the period, also present in the household were Jeffrey C's Servant, Elizabeth (born 1865 in Manfield, Yorkshire, England) and Jeffrey C's Servant, Thomas (born 1866 in Manfield, Yorkshire, England).
